“…There are several ways to reconstruct bronchial bifurcation. Wedge plasty, end-to-end plasty, and double barrel methods have been reported [7][8][9][10][11] ; meanwhile, the Miyamoto's technique has not been reported before. We adopted the Miyamoto's technique in our case because the carina and right bronchial bifurcation were similar in shape.…”
